数据库语言,是用于与数据库进行交互的语言。通过这些语言,我们可以对数据库中的数据进行增删改查等操作,实现数据的管理和维护。
最常见的数据库语言:SQL
- SQL(Structured Query Language,结构化查询语言)是目前最广泛使用的数据库语言。
- 功能强大: SQL可以用于创建、修改和删除数据库和表;插入、更新和删除数据;查询数据;定义视图、索引等。
- 标准化: SQL具有标准化的语法,使得它可以在不同的数据库管理系统(DBMS)中使用。
SQL的基本操作:
数据定义语言): 用于定义数据库对象,如创建、修改和删除表、索引、视图等数据操纵语言): 用于对数据库中的数据进行增删改查操作: 删除数据
数据控制语言): 用于控制数据库 洪都拉斯电话号码数据用户对数据的访问权限。: 授予权限
收回权限
SQL示例:
SQL
-- 创建一个名为users的表
CREATE TABLE users (
id INT PRIMARY KEY,
name VARCHAR(50),
email VARCHAR(100)
);
-- 插入一条数据
INSERT INTO users (id, name, email)
VALUES (1, '张三', '[email protected]');
-- 查询所有用户
SELECT * FROM users;
其他数据库语言
除了SQL,还有一些其他的数据库语言,如:
- NoSQL数据库语言: MongoDB的查询语言是基于JSON的,Cassandra使用CQL(Cassandra Query Language)等。
- 过程化语言: 一些数据库系 塞浦路斯电话号码资料 统支持嵌入式的过程化语言,如PL/SQL(Oracle)、T-SQL(SQL Server)等,用于编写复杂的存储过程和函数。
为什么学习SQL很重要?
- 数据分析: SQL是数据分析的基础,可以从海量数据中提取有价值的信息。
- 数据库管理: SQL是管理数据库的必备工具。
- 数据科学: 许多数据科学工具和库都依赖于SQL。
- 就业前景: 掌握SQL技能可以大大提高就业竞争力。
学习SQL的建议
- 从基础开始: 掌握SQL的基本语法和常用操作。
- 多练习: 通过大量的练习来巩固知识。
- 实践项目: 将学到的知识应用到实际项目中。
- 在线学习资源: 利用各种在线教程、课程和社区进行学习。
总结
数据库语言,尤其是SQL,是数据库开发人员和数据分析师必备的技能。通过学习和掌握数据库语言,我们可以高效地管理和分析数据,为各种应用提供数据支持。
想进一步了解数据库语言,可以深入学习以下内容:
- SQL高级特性: 子查询、连接、聚合函数、窗口函数等。
- 数据库优化: 索引、视图、存储过程等优化技术。
- NoSQL数据库: MongoDB、Cassandra等NoSQL数据库的查询语言。
- 大数据技术: Hadoop、Spark等大数据平台的SQL接口。
如果你有关于数据库语言的任何问题,欢迎随时提问!
例如,你可以问我:
- 如何在SQL中实现分页查询?
- 什么是索引?索引的作用是什么?
- 如何优化SQL查询性能?
我将竭诚为您解答。